Inglewood is pleased to welcome Hall Of Fame LWer
Harry Watson into the fold. I really like what Watson brings to my team in a number of areas. Offense, defense, skating, hitting, fighting, leadership, board work, clutch play...Watson was a beauty.
He was a very reliable goal scorer, placing as high as 2nd in the NHL. In the 10 year span from 1947-1956, only Richard, Howe, and Lindsay scored more goals.
He was massive for his day (6'1, 200+), but had very good speed. He was a feared fighter and bodychecker, but played a very clean game that rarely saw him take penalties. He was very effective at checking the opposition's top forwards, and had documented success in this regard against Gordie Howe. He played a prominent role on 5 Stanley Cups with 2 franchises, and was often notable for his clutch play at both ends of the rink in the post-season.
